DNSCrypt is a network protocol that authenticates and encrypts Domain Name System ( DNS ) traffic between the user's computer and recursive name servers, with support for modern encrypted DNS protocols such as DNSCrypt v2 , DNS-over-HTTPS , Anonymized DNSCrypt and ODoH (Oblivious DoH) . Follow installation instructions here . Alternatively -- and the best choice for Mageiam, IMHO -- you can download the x86_64 version of dnscrypt-proxy from OpenMandriva here . The OpenMandriva-sourced package will install, but show an error that can be safely ignored. This package is superior to that provided with Mageia and is the most current version of the application, but you will need to block the update of the package to the Mageia version by adding its name to /etc/urpmi/skip.list .
